作曲家网络启动命令失败

时间:2018-12-19 07:50:16

标签: docker hyperledger-fabric hyperledger hyperledger-composer

suma@ubuntu:~/poc/land$ composer network start --networkName property-network --networkVersion 0.2.6-deploy.113 --card PeerAdmin@hlfv1 -A admin -S adminpw --file networkadmin.card Starting business network property-network at version 0.2.6-deploy.113

  

处理以下网络管理员:       userName:管理员

     

✖启动业务网络定义。这可能需要一分钟...   错误:尝试启动业务网络时出错。错误:任何对等方均未提供有效响应。   来自尝试的对等通信的响应是一个错误:错误:无法执行事务ae276da81f756ac76edccf85a79f1c11a554f1285c2a8c4cc2899db433220500:错误启动容器:错误启动容器:无法生成特定于平台的Docker构建:从构建返回的错误:1“ npm WARN通知[SECURITY] hoek有以下漏洞:1中级,请访问此处获取更多详细信息:https://nodesecurity.io/advisories?search=hoek&version=2.16.3-运行npm i npm@latest -g升级npm版本,然后运行npm audit获取更多信息。   npm WARN不推荐使用boom@2.10.1:此版本不再维护。请升级到最新版本。   npm WARN不建议使用cryptiles@2.0.5:此版本不再维护。请升级到最新版本。   npm WARN不推荐使用hoek@2.16.3:此版本不再维护。请升级到最新版本。   npm WARN不推荐使用boom@4.3.1:此版本不再维护。请升级到最新版本。

     

x509@0.3.3安装/ chaincode / output / node_modules / x509   node-gyp重建

     

gyp错误!配置错误   糟糕!错误:找不到Python可执行文件“ python”,可以设置PYTHON env变量。   糟糕!堆叠在PythonFinder.failNoPython(/usr/local/lib/node_modules/npm/node_modules/node-gyp/lib/configure.js:483:19)   糟糕!放在PythonFinder中。 (/usr/local/lib/node_modules/npm/node_modules/node-gyp/lib/configure.js:397:16)   糟糕!堆栈在F(/usr/local/lib/node_modules/npm/node_modules/which/which.js:68:16)   糟糕!堆叠在E(/usr/local/lib/node_modules/npm/node_modules/which/which.js:80:29)   糟糕!堆栈在/usr/local/lib/node_modules/npm/node_modules/which/which.js:89:16   糟糕!堆栈在/usr/local/lib/node_modules/npm/node_modules/which/node_modules/isexe/index.js:42:5   糟糕!堆栈在/usr/local/lib/node_modules/npm/node_modules/which/node_modules/isexe/mode.js:8:5   糟糕! FSReqWrap.oncomplete上的堆栈(fs.js:152:21)   糟糕!系统Linux 4.10.0-28-通用   糟糕!命令“ / usr / local / bin / node”“ /usr/local/lib/node_modules/npm/node_modules/node-gyp/bin/node-gyp.js”“重建”   糟糕! cwd / chaincode / output / node_modules / x509   糟糕!节点-v v8.4.0   糟糕!节点gyp -v v3.6.2   糟糕!不好   npm WARN包含composer-common软件包,既包含在开发环境中,又包含在生产环境中。      

npm错误!代码ELIFECYCLE   npm ERR! errno 1   npm ERR! x509@0.3.3安装:node-gyp rebuild   npm ERR!退出状态1   npm ERR!   npm ERR! x509@0.3.3安装脚本失败。   npm ERR! npm可能不是问题。上面可能还有其他日志记录输出。

     

npm错误!可以在以下位置找到此运行的完整日志:   npm ERR! /root/.npm/_logs/2018-12-19T06_43_46_434Z-debug.log   ”   命令失败

FABRIC_VERSION=hlfv12 COMPOSER_VERSION=v0.20.5 NODE_VERSION=v8.14.1 NPM_VERSION=6.4.1

我已经完成了./teardownfabric和./stopFabric,然后再次启动结构并创建了对等管理卡。

1 个答案:

答案 0 :(得分:2)

这很可能是由用于构建链码图像的旧图像或错误图像引起的。只要您没有将对等方重新配置为使用其他构建映像,那么最简单的解决方法就是删除您可能拥有的ccenv映像,例如您可以尝试

docker rmi $(docker images hyperledger/fabric-ccenv* -q) -f

强制删除所有ccenv图片